LinkedIn opens Sydney office for 1 million Australian members

LinkedIn Sydney

LinkedIn have opened for business in Sydney after surpassing one million members in Australia and more than 60 million members globally.

LinkedIn have appointed Steve Barham from LinkedIn’s headquarters in Mount View, Calif. to take the role of director for recruitment solutions for LinkedIn Australia and New Zealand in their new Pitt St Sydney office.

“We’re seeing great momentum as we connect more and more Australian professionals and provide them a platform to advance their careers,” said Clifford Rosenberg, managing director of LinkedIn Australia and New Zealand. “Our research confirms that networking is critical to Australian professionals in order to achieve their goals and build their businesses. LinkedIn offers a highly effective way for them to network in a timely manner online or via their mobile.”

“By establishing a local presence, we can focus on developing strategic partnerships to enhance LinkedIn usage. Our marketing efforts will be directed towards raising awareness for our premium subscriptions, advertising, recruitment products and driving user engagement,” he added.

LinkedIn has a strong business model that is comprised of user subscriptions, online advertising and enterprise software licensing. Recruiters find LinkedIn powerful as it not only provides them the opportunity to target active candidates looking for jobs, but they can also reach out to passive candidates.
